On June 14, 2015, over 100 heavily-armed special forces clad in military fatigues with their faces obscured by balaclavas raided the homes of residents of Georgia’s Pankisi Gorge whom they suspected of recruiting for the Islamic State. Captured by video and still cameras, the media blitz that accompanied the operation seemed more intended for broadcast and publication the next day than to address the problem of radicalisation in Georgia.
